The Certificate in Business Forecasting and Research is a specialized program designed to equip students with the skills and knowledge necessary to analyze and interpret complex business data, making informed decisions about future market trends and opportunities.
This program focuses on teaching students how to develop and implement effective forecasting models, as well as how to conduct thorough market research to identify areas of growth and potential risks.
Upon completion of the program, students will have gained a solid understanding of business forecasting and research techniques, including data analysis, statistical modeling, and data visualization.
The duration of the Certificate in Business Forecasting and Research typically ranges from 6 to 12 months, depending on the institution and the student's prior experience and background.
The program is highly relevant to the business world, as companies are constantly seeking professionals who can provide accurate and timely forecasts to inform strategic decision-making.
Graduates of the Certificate in Business Forecasting and Research can pursue careers in various industries, including finance, marketing, and management consulting, where their skills in data analysis and forecasting will be highly valued.
The program is also beneficial for entrepreneurs and small business owners, who can use the skills and knowledge gained to develop more accurate business plans and forecasts, ultimately leading to better decision-making and increased success.
